Bereitstellen von Konfigurationen (Flow, Datei, Knoten) - Manual - Flow Creator - Industrial Edge - Data Connection - Documentation of the Flow Creator for Industrial Edge

Flow Creator

Product
Flow Creator
Product Version
v1.19.0
Edition
04/2025
Language
Deutsch
  1. Rufen Sie das Autorisierungstoken des IEM-Benutzers ab, indem Sie die IEM-API "/login/direct" aufrufen.
  2. Rufen Sie die Anwendungs-ID der Flow Creator- oder Flow Creator(arm64)-App ab, indem Sie die IEM-API "/applications" aufrufen.Stellen Sie sicher, dass die für die Konfiguration erforderliche Flow Creator- oder Flow Creator-App (arm64) in den IEM-Katalog kopiert wird.
  3. Rufen Sie die Geräte-ID(s) aller IE-Geräte ab, die in das IEM integriert sind, indem Sie die IEM-GET-API "/devices" von IEM aufrufen.Stellen Sie sicher, dass die für die Konfiguration erforderliche Flow Creator- oder Flow Creator-App (arm64) auf den IE-Geräten installiert ist.Sie können die IEM-Datei "devices/installed-apps" verwenden, um zu überprüfen, ob die Flow Creator- oder Flow Creator-App (arm64) auf einem IE-Gerät installiert ist.
  4. Rufen Sie eine Batch-ID ab, indem Sie die IEM-POST-API "/batches" aufrufen und den Anforderungstext im Format multipart/form-data übergeben.Übergeben Sie in Parametern den 'appid'-Wert aus Schritt 2 oben und den 'operation'-Wert als 'installApplication'. Im Anforderungstext ist nur ein Gerätearray erforderlich, das eine beliebige Geräte-ID aus Schritt 3 übergibt.

  5. Rufen Sie die API "/provision" auf, um den Konfigurator-API-Server mithilfe der Batch-ID aus Schritt 4 zu initialisieren.

  6. Laden Sie einen Flow, eine Datei oder einen Knoten auf den Konfigurator-API-Server hoch.Für den Durchfluss: Laden Sie eine Flow-Datei hoch, indem Sie die API "/flows/{fileName}" aufrufen, nachdem Sie die Flow-JSON-Dateifür die Datei bereitgestellt haben: Laden Sie eine Datei hoch, indem Sie die API "/files/{fileName}" aufrufen, nachdem Sie die gültige Datei angehängt haben.Für Knoten: Laden Sie eine .tgz-Datei hoch, indem Sie die API "/custom-nodes/{fileName}" aufrufen, nachdem Sie die gültige Datei angefügt haben.

  7. Rufen Sie die API "/deploy" auf. Übergeben Sie eine oder mehrere Geräte-IDs aus Schritt 3 an den Anforderungstext. Dadurch werden die Konfigurationen Ihrer Wahl vom Konfigurator-API-Server auf die ausgewählten IE-Geräte bereitgestellt, indem für jedes IE-Gerät ein Job erstellt wird.

  8. Um einen Auftrag in IED nachzuverfolgen, rufen Sie die Status-API "/job/status/{type}" auf, um den Fortschritt eines Auftrags auf einem IE-Gerät zu überprüfen. Warten Sie, bis der zurückgegebene Auftragsstatus "COMPLETED" lautet

  9. Um Geräteereignisse für die App zu überprüfen, rufen Sie "/devices/status/connections" auf, um alle Ereignisse vom IE-Gerät für die Flow Creator-Anwendung abzurufen, z. B. den Bereitstellungsstatus des letzten Flows, der letzten Datei oder des letzten Knotens, der mit der API "/deploy" bereitgestellt wurde, sowie alle Fehlermeldungen. Die neuesten Ereignisse werden erst empfangen, nachdem der Auftrag auf dem/den IE-Gerät(en) abgeschlossen wurde.